One-Pot Veggie Pasta is the ultimate comfort food that combines fresh vegetables and pasta in a single pot, making it a fantastic option for busy weeknights or casual gatherings. In just 20 minutes, you can whip up this hearty dish that’s bursting with flavor and nutrition. With minimal preparation and cleanup, this one-pot wonder is perfect for families or anyone looking to enjoy a delicious meal without the hassle. Customize it with your favorite seasonal veggies or pasta shapes, and experience a delightful balance of taste and convenience.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 medium red onion, finely chopped
  • 2 large garlic cloves, chopped
  • 1 medium red bell pepper, diced
  • 1 medium zucchini, diced
  • 250 g mushrooms, sliced
  • 2 tablespoons tomato paste
  • 1/2 tablespoon Italian seasoning mix
  • 500 ml vegetable stock (or water)
  • 250 g uncooked short pasta
  • 500 ml pasta sauce
  • 125 g light mozzarella cheese, grated
  • Salt and black p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Heat olive oil in a large deep pan over medium heat. Sauté onion, garlic, and red bell pepper for 3-4 minutes until softened.
  2. Add zucchini and mushrooms; cook for another 1-2 minutes.
  3. Stir in tomato paste and Italian seasoning; then add vegetable stock, uncooked pasta, and pasta sauce. Mix well.
  4. Bring to a boil, stir, cover with a lid, and simmer on medium-low for about 10 minutes or until pasta is al dente.
  5. Stir in mozzarella cheese; cover again for 1-2 minutes to melt the cheese.
  6. Season with salt and pepper; serve hot.
